On the Visual Colour of Martian Polar Deposits

Abstract

The OMEGA imaging spectrometer provides contiguous spectral images at ~1 km spatial scale in the 0.36 – 5.2 ìm wavelength range. Since beginning of its operations in January 2004, it has mapped the Martian polar deposits several times at different seasons. In this paper we have studied the spectral characteristics of these deposits in the visual range. In particular, we report on the spectral characteris tics of the interlayer deposits which show a distinct bluer colour compared to the surrounding ice-free terrains. The implications on the deposition and nature of these deposits are discussed.
